Output 68d519f1ec8f9438c105be37fb93079fd8d0fa5c67572e8e13c482988408f776:0

value
79658536
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 524bb076ee05d216b3dee05b3fd0bc1ed8abec36 OP_EQUALVERIFY OP_CHECKSIG
address
18W95iXDKpwZsKUwYHAWh9pqdJPftEVWiE
transaction
68d519f1ec8f9438c105be37fb93079fd8d0fa5c67572e8e13c482988408f776
spent
true